Present: Ops, Procurement, Finance leads.

1. Sole reliance on Tannerhall Alloys flagged as unacceptable risk after their Q2 delays.
2. Procurement shortlisted three candidate second sources; two passed initial quality screens.
3. Qualification trials to run eight weeks. Budget impact estimated and circulated to finance separately.
4. Dual-sourcing target: 30% volume shifted within two quarters.
5. No change to customer commitments in the interim.

Actions assigned; next review in four weeks. The strategic note for finance appears below.

internal memo for bahap-yagug: Headcount on the Ulaix team goes from 3 to 100 by the end of January. Gross margin on Ulaix came in at 10 percent against a plan of 15 percent.

Branch managers: the proposed training allocation for Fennora Retail Group rises 8% overall, weighted toward customer-service certification and the new Ledgerpoint till system. Each branch will receive a baseline allotment plus a performance-linked supplement, calculated from this year's completion rates. Please review your draft figures carefully and flag discrepancies before the planning summit in Osterfield. Unused funds will no longer roll over. The confidential note below explains how this budget aligns with broader business plans.

internal memo for kawip-hadug: Headcount on the Wenwyn team goes from 7 to 140 by the end of January. Gross margin on Wenwyn came in at 20 percent against a plan of 15 percent.

**Handover note: Tilescout prefetcher**

Handing off the Tilescout map-tile prefetcher ahead of the 4.2 release. It predicts which tiles users will pan to and warms the CDN accordingly. Prefetch aggressiveness was tuned down last month after we saturated origin bandwidth, so please don't bump it back without load testing. The scheduler and the fetch workers share one config file. The values currently deployed to production are as follows.

config for kafof-bawef:
holath:
  log_level: debug
  metrics_host: metrics.holath.qorvelsys.internal
  pin: 2191
  pool_size: 32